Butters is HANDS DOWN one of my new favorite breakfast/brunch spots in town and my only disappointment is that I didn't discover this place sooner! I came here with five coworkers for brunch and ordered the "build your own omelette" deal and it was terrific. The omelette was enormous (honestly looked like at least 8 eggs!) and it came with breakfast potatoes and two large pancakes. They really do give you A LOT of food for $10 bucks which is becoming increasingly uncommon in Scottsdale. I love that they don't "a la carte" you to death the way so many other brunching establishments do! Anyway, I loved absolutely everything- the omelette was extremely tasty (could've used a bit more cheese though), the potatoes were lightly cooked (not burned to a crisp like so many places!) and really, really good. Also the pancakes were fluffy and flavorful. Most of my coworkers ordered salad or sandwiches with fries and honestly I was salivating over their plates as well as mine. Everything looked SO delicious- especially the French fries. I must try those on my next visit!
